- PR -

NTPの同期について・・・

投稿者投稿内容
ya_gi
会議室デビュー日: 2005/10/04
投稿数: 3
投稿日時: 2005-10-04 19:14
初者です。よろしくお願いいたします。
catalyst3750にてローカル上のNTPサーバを使用したくて
"NTP server xxx.xxx.xxx.xxx"とグローバルコンフィグレーションモード
およびバージョンも設定しましたが、
”unsynchronized…”と表示され同期がとれていないのですが、
基本的な設定が抜けているのか、ローカル上のNTPサーバに問題が
あるのでしょうか?・・・m(_ _)m
未記入
会議室デビュー日: 2005/10/04
投稿数: 6
投稿日時: 2005-10-04 19:56
ntpには確かadjustまで数分から十数分待たなければならない仕様があったような.
あとserverとの時刻差が1000secを超えると同期しないとかいう仕様もあったような.
たみお
会議室デビュー日: 2004/10/02
投稿数: 11
投稿日時: 2005-10-17 02:55
もう解決しているかもしれませんが。

引用:
catalyst3750にてローカル上のNTPサーバを使用したくて
"NTP server xxx.xxx.xxx.xxx"とグローバルコンフィグレーションモード
およびバージョンも設定しましたが、


Cat3750をNTPサーバとして公開したいということでしょうか?
ちなみにCat3750はNTPサーバになることはできません。
 →NTPクライアントとしてNTPサーバを参照することは可能です。
CiscoルータやCat6500等の上位機種スイッチであれば、
ntp master strutm
を使用して、自身をNTPサーバとして公開することが可能です。

NTPクライアントになるだけであれば、
ya_giさんが書かれているとおり、
ntp server xxx.xxx.xxx.xxx で可能です。

動作確認は、show ntp associations を実行して下さい。
ya_gi
会議室デビュー日: 2005/10/04
投稿数: 3
投稿日時: 2005-10-17 16:46
引用:

未記入さんの書き込み (2005-10-04 19:56) より:
ntpには確かadjustまで数分から十数分待たなければならない仕様があったような.
あとserverとの時刻差が1000secを超えると同期しないとかいう仕様もあったような.


返信が遅くなり、大変申し訳ありませんでした。
何回かトライしてみましたが結果は、変わりませんでした。
ちなみに、インターネットのNTPサーバとは良好ですが、Windows2000/WindowsXPの
NTPサーバを起動した際に同期がとれません。
遅くなりましたが、ご指導ありがとうございました。
SPICE
会議室デビュー日: 2004/07/21
投稿数: 1
投稿日時: 2005-10-17 17:52
はじめて書き込みします。
ちょっと遅かったかもしれませんが。。。

引用:

ya_giさんの書き込み (2005-10-17 16:46) より:
ちなみに、インターネットのNTPサーバとは良好ですが、Windows2000/WindowsXPの
NTPサーバを起動した際に同期がとれません。


Windows2000/XPのNTPサーバの機能は、SNTPと呼ばれる簡易なプロトコルを
使用しています。
一方、Ciscoのルータ・スイッチのNTPクライアントの機能は、廉価版の
ルータ(Cisco800シリーズや1700シリーズ)はSNTPを、それ以外の機種は
NTPを使用しています。

NTP/SNTPサーバ・クライアント相互間の同期可否は、以下の通りとなります。

(1)NTPサーバ⇔NTPクライアント ○
(2)NTPサーバ⇔SNTPクライアント ○
(3)SNTPサーバ⇔NTPクライアント ×
(4)SNTPサーバ⇔SNTPクライアント ○

今回のya_giさんのケースでは、

Windows2000/WindowsXP‥‥SNTPサーバ
catalyst3750 ‥‥‥‥‥‥NTPクライアント

となり、上記の(3)に該当しますので、残念ながらNTP同期はできません。
ya_giさんが試されたインターネットのNTPサーバは、恐らくSNTPではなく
純正の(?)NTPサーバのため、問題なく同期できていると思われます。

なおプロトコルの詳細に関する突っ込みは、私もわからないのでご勘弁下さい。
以前ya_giさんと同様のトラブルに遭遇した経験があったので、参考になれば
と思い、書き込みさせていただきました。
ya_gi
会議室デビュー日: 2005/10/04
投稿数: 3
投稿日時: 2005-10-17 18:48
引用:

SPICEさんの書き込み (2005-10-17 17:52) より:
はじめて書き込みします。
ちょっと遅かったかもしれませんが。。。

引用:

ya_giさんの書き込み (2005-10-17 16:46) より:
ちなみに、インターネットのNTPサーバとは良好ですが、Windows2000/WindowsXPの
NTPサーバを起動した際に同期がとれません。


Windows2000/WindowsXP‥‥SNTPサーバ
catalyst3750 ‥‥‥‥‥‥NTPクライアント



"未記入"様・"たみお"様・"SPICE"様、大変参考となりました、
ありがとうございました。スッキリしました!!
つまり、私がやろうと思っていたことは、無理な話だったんですネ↓
誠にお騒がせして申し訳ありませんでした。
くちぱっち
会議室デビュー日: 2005/12/27
投稿数: 3
投稿日時: 2005-12-27 10:36
http://www.atmarkit.co.jp/fwin2k/operation/winntp01/winntp01_01.html
WindowsXP/2003はSNTPではなくNTPサーバです。
よってこのスレッドは未解決と思います。
くちぱっち
会議室デビュー日: 2005/12/27
投稿数: 3
投稿日時: 2006-01-24 14:02
追記します。

WindowsXPをマイクロソフト記述の方法
http://support.microsoft.com/kb/314054/JA/
でローカルNTPにして、Etherealでキャプチャすると、NTPリクエストに対して
時刻を返すのですが、NTP返信内のフィールドが
Reference Clock ID: .LOCL. (uncalibrated local clock)
というものになっています。

一方、LinuxとかでローカルNTPを作ると、ntp.confの設定次第で、
Reference Clock ID: LOCAL(1) (127.1.1.1)
というものになります。

この部分が違うのでCiscoルータが反応しない可能性があります。
(どこにもこのことを記述したドキュメントがありませんが)
何か情報ある方、いませんでしょうか?

スキルアップ/キャリアアップ(JOB@IT)